About Mark A. Bankston at a glance

Mark A. Bankston is a Senior Associate based in Houston, Texas, practicing at Johnson DeLuca Kurisky & Gould A Professional Corporation. They have 29+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1997. Their practice focuses on personal injury, business, litigation, and consumer. Admitted to practice in Texas US Supreme Court Texas Southern District/Bankruptcy Court Texas Western District Court (1997), U.S. District Court, Southern District of Texas (1998), U.S. Court of Appeals, Fifth Circuit and U.S. Supreme Court (2001), and U.S. District Court, Eastern District of Texas (2002). Educated at South Texas College of Law (J.D., 1997) and Lamar University (B.A., 1993). Active member of State Bar of Texas Houston Bar Association.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Texas

Practicing law in Texas. Legal matters in Texas are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Houston are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Texas state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Texas br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Texas cour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
